JUSTICE RAKESH KUMAR ORAL ORDER 20-05-2016 Heard Sri Ravi Shankar Sahay, learned counsel, who was assisted by Sri Ajay Nandan Sahay, learned counsel for the petitioner and learned Addl. Public Prosecutor. The sole petitioner apprehends his arrest in connection with Kudra P.S. Case no.85/2016 registered for the offence under Sections 47 of the Bihar Excise (Amendment) Act, 2016.
It was submitted by learned counsel for the petitioner that it is true that from Khalihan of the petitioner, about 400 Liters of country liquor was recovered, but the petitioner was having no connection with the said liquor.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that only with a view of implicate the petitioner, some one had put the said country liquor. On the aforesaid ground,
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.22533 of 2016 (2) dt.20-05-2016 2/2 a prayer has been made for grant of anticipatory bail. Keeping in view the fact that from Khalihan of the petitioner, such huge quantity of liquor was recovered, it is not a fit case for extending the privilege of anticipatory bail. The petition stands dismissed.
